MINUTES OF COUNCIL <br /> SPECIAL MEETING <br /> MARCH 24, 2013 <br /> The Batesville City Council met in special session on March 24, at 4:30 PM at the <br /> Municipal Building. Mayor Elumbaugh called the meeting to order. Upon roll call, the <br /> following council answered present; Tommy Bryant, Margarett Henley, Paige Hubbard, <br /> Davy Insell, Fred Krug, and Chris Poole. Also present were the City Clerk Denise <br /> Johnston and the City Attorney Lindsey Castleberry. Councilmember's Matthews and <br /> Shetron were absent. <br /> NEW BUSINESS <br /> A) CONSIDER A RESOLUTION TO APPROVE A LEASE AGREEMENT FOR NEW <br /> DUMP TRUCKS <br /> Councilmember Insell introduced a resolution to authorize the execution of an <br /> equipment lease-purchase agreement between the City of Batesville and <br /> BancorpSouth Bank for the purpose of leasing three 2013 dump trucks. <br /> Councilmember Henley moved to suspend the rules and read the resolution by <br /> title only. Councilmember Insell seconded and the roll call count was 6 for and 0 <br /> against. Mr. Castleberry read the resolution by title only. The Mayor said two of <br /> the dump trucks will be in the Utility Construction Department and one in the City <br /> Street Department. The purchase is to replace existing leases and is budgeted <br /> for. Councilmember Bryant moved to adopt the resolution and Councilmember <br /> Henley seconded. The roll call count was 6 for and 0 against. The resolution <br /> was given #2013-04-01-R. <br /> ADJOURNMENT <br />
